Molybdenum particulate inhalation

Molybdenum dust generated during application or scraping may be inhaled in poorly ventilated spaces. Occupational exposure limits exist for molybdenum; consumer exposure from ski wax is minimal but not zero, especially during aggressive scraping without a dust mask.

Dermal irritation or allergic contact

Hydrocarbon wax blends can cause mild skin irritation or contact sensitization in individuals with sensitive skin or existing dermatitis. No brand-specific allergic reactions have been documented, but prolonged skin contact should be avoided.

Thermal degradation of hydrocarbon blend

Overheating the wax with an iron exceeding safe temperatures may cause incomplete combustion or release of volatile organic compounds (VOCs). Proper heat control minimizes this risk but is operator-dependent.

The full breakdown

What it's made of and why it matters

Maplus Xcelerate Pro 2 is a hydrocarbon-based ski wax blend formulated with molybdenum (a solid lubricant additive) to reduce friction on snow. The molybdenum acts as a dry lubricant and does not dissolve into the wax matrix, meaning it remains as a dispersed solid throughout the product. Ski waxes are applied as thin coatings to ski bases and are not ingested or absorbed systemically, limiting exposure pathways to skin contact and minor inhalation during application.

The brand's record and disclosure

Maplus is an established Italian ski wax manufacturer with no documented product recalls or safety controversies in public records. The brand does not publicly disclose detailed ingredient lists or third-party testing certifications for heavy metals or contaminants. No PFAS stance or communication has been found from the manufacturer, which is typical for smaller regional ski wax brands that do not market to consumer sustainability concerns.

How it compares in its category

Maplus waxes occupy the mid-performance segment of ski wax products. Competitors in this category (Swix, Toko, Dominator) similarly use hydrocarbon bases with mineral additives and do not routinely disclose full composition or independent safety testing. Molybdenum-blended waxes are common in performance formulations and are not considered hazardous in this application. No category-wide safety issues have emerged for ski waxes as a product class.

If you buy it

Apply in a well-ventilated space to minimize inhalation of wax dust and molybdenum particles. Use a wax iron on low-to-medium heat (not exceeding 160C) to avoid degradation of the hydrocarbon matrix and potential emission of volatile organic compounds. Wash hands after application to remove surface wax residue. Store in a cool, dry place away from direct heat; replace when the base coat becomes uneven or yellowed, typically after 5-10 ski days depending on snow conditions.
